Turning Tool Holder SVVCN 72.5°, Indexable Insert Holder, Lathe Tool
The SVVCN tool holder with a 72.5° approach angle combines the contour accessibility of a pointed 35° indexable carbide insert with the cutting stability of a shallow approach angle – a turning tool that plays to its strengths in both profile turning and heavy longitudinal turning. As a neutral tool holder, it is designed for all VC.. indexable carbide inserts and can be used in both right-hand and left-hand rotation.
The 72.5° approach angle directs a significant portion of the cutting forces axially into the shank, relieving the radial direction – this noticeably stabilises the process at high depths of cut and allows greater cutting depths per pass than steeper approach angles. At the same time, the 35° nose angle of the VC insert maintains a large clearance area that enables access to tight profile transitions and pointed contours. The body, made from heat-treated tool steel, provides the bending rigidity that is critical for smooth cutting under load. The screw clamping system secures the insert precisely and enables quick changes. The neutral design eliminates the need for a second holder for the opposite direction – saving tooling costs and simplifying tool management.
